		<description>hi,
  I have a question about the property tax. The house I am going to purchase had the market value of around 950,000 (not sure) in 2007 and the current property tax for this house is about 12,000 a year. If I buy this house today at the price of 500,000 then the property tax will base on this purchased price (500,000) which is around 6,000 a year or it will base on the current market value which is around 700,000. Thank you in advance.</description>
